Sahel conflicts are a series of overlapping armed struggles in the Sahel region of Africa involving jihadist insurgencies, communal violence, and state fragility that have created one of the world’s most severe humanitarian and security crises.

  • A. Horn of Africa conflicts
    Horn of Africa conflicts refers to the overlapping civil wars, insurgencies, and interstate tensions in countries like Somalia, Ethiopia, and Eritrea that have made the region one of the most unstable and militarized in the world.
  • B. Darfur conflict
    The Darfur conflict is a protracted armed struggle in western Sudan marked by mass atrocities, displacement, and accusations of genocide against government-backed militias targeting non-Arab populations.
  • C. Casamance conflict
    The Casamance conflict is a long-running low-intensity separatist insurgency in southern Senegal, where rebels have sought independence from the central government since the early 1980s.
  • D. Chadian–Libyan conflict
    The Chadian–Libyan conflict was a series of armed confrontations from the 1970s to the late 1980s in which Libya, under Muammar Gaddafi, intervened militarily in Chad over territorial disputes and regional influence, culminating in Libya’s defeat and withdrawal.
  • E. South Sudanese Civil War
    The South Sudanese Civil War was a brutal internal conflict that erupted in 2013 between forces loyal to President Salva Kiir and those aligned with former Vice President Riek Machar, causing massive displacement, ethnic violence, and humanitarian crisis in the world’s newest country.
